Strawberry Cheesecake Dessert Tacos

Discover the delightful combination of flavors and textures in these Strawberry Cheesecake Dessert Tacos – the Best Sweet Taco Recipe. These delectable treats feature crispy cinnamon-sugar taco shells filled with a light and fluffy cheesecake mixture, topped with a homemade strawberry sauce. Perfect for parties, BBQs, or casual gatherings, these tacos offer a fun twist on traditional desserts that will impress your guests. Easy to make and customizable with your favorite fruits, this recipe is sure to become a go-to for entertaining or as a simple yet elegant sweet treat.

Ingredients

  • 6 small flour tortillas
  • ½ cup granulated sugar
  • 1 tbsp ground cinnamon
  • ½ cup unsalted butter, melted
  • 8 oz cream cheese, softened
  • ½ cup powdered sugar
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• ½ cup heavy whipping cream
  • 1 cup fresh or frozen strawberries, chopped
  • ¼ cup granulated sugar (for the topping)
  • 1 tbsp lemon juice
  • 1 tbsp cornstarch mixed with 2 tbsp water

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C). Mix the sugar and cinnamon in a small bowl.
  2. Brush each tortilla with melted butter and coat with the cinnamon-sugar mix.
  3. Shape tortillas over an oven rack or inverted muffin tin and bake for 8–10 minutes until crisp. Cool completely.
  4. For the filling, beat cream cheese, powdered sugar, and vanilla until smooth. Whip heavy cream separately, then fold into the cheese mixture.
  5. In a saucepan, combine strawberries, sugar, and lemon juice; simmer for about 5 minutes. Add cornstarch slurry and stir until thickened; let cool.
  6. Fill cooled taco shells with cheesecake mixture and top with strawberry sauce before serving.
